Discover Ludwig"full measurements" is a correct and usable phrase in written English
It can be used when describing the complete or exact measurements of something. For example: - The tailor took my full measurements before making my custom suit. - The recipe calls for full measurements of all ingredients for the best results. - The architect provided the full measurements of the building in the blueprints. - The scientist recorded the full measurements of the specimen before conducting the experiment.
